VM重置 VPS,如何通过虚拟机管理VPS服务
卡尔云官网
www.kaeryun.com
在现代云计算和虚拟化技术普及的今天,虚拟机(VM)和虚拟专用服务器(VPS)已经成为很多开发者和企业的重要工具,VM是一种在物理服务器上运行的虚拟环境,而VPS则是在这些虚拟机上提供的网络服务,类似于物理服务器,但成本更低,如果你正在使用VM来管理你的VPS,那么了解如何通过VM重置VPS可能会非常有帮助,本文将详细解释什么是VM和VPS,以及如何通过VM来重置和管理VPS服务。
什么是VM和VPS?
虚拟机(VM)
虚拟机是指在物理服务器上运行的虚拟环境,通过虚拟化技术,物理服务器可以同时运行多个虚拟机,每个虚拟机都有自己的操作系统和资源,虚拟机可以独立于物理服务器运行,这意味着你可以将一个虚拟机迁移到不同的物理服务器上,而不会影响其他虚拟机。
虚拟专用服务器(VPS)
虚拟专用服务器(VPS)是一种网络服务,它基于虚拟机提供,类似于物理服务器,VPS通常用于 hosting 网站、应用程序或服务,因为它们提供了更高的灵活性和成本效益,VPS服务通常包括稳定的网络连接、独立的IP地址和配置选项。
为什么需要通过VM重置VPS?
在使用VM管理VPS时,有时候需要对VPS进行重置或重新配置,这可能包括:
- 密码重置:如果VPS的密码丢失或被遗忘,你需要重置密码。
- 网络配置:如果需要调整VPS的网络设置(如IP地址、端口映射或防火墙规则),可能需要通过VM进行配置。
- 服务重启:VPS服务可能需要重启,以确保所有配置生效。
如何通过VM重置VPS?
确保VPS连接到VM
在开始任何操作之前,确保VPS已经连接到对应的VM,如果你还没有连接,可以使用网络连接工具(如 telnet
或 ftp
)将VPS连接到VM。
telnet VM-IP 22
启动VPS
在VM中,VPS通常可以通过远程登录或图形界面启动,假设你使用的是SSH登录,可以执行以下命令启动VPS:
sudo ssh -p user@VM-IP
重置VPS密码
如果你需要重置VPS的密码,可以执行以下命令:
sudo vps-root -r
这将进入VPS的root账户,你可以在此处修改密码。
配置VPS网络
如果你需要调整VPS的网络设置,可以使用VPS的管理控制台或命令行工具,你可以通过以下命令查看当前的IP地址:
sudo ping -t 8.8.8.8
如果需要更改IP地址,可以执行:
sudo nslookup -I -y 8.8.8.8 sudo nslookup -y 8.8.8.8
启动VPS服务
VPS服务可能需要重新启动才能生效,你可以通过以下命令启动VPS服务:
sudo systemctl start vps sudo systemctl restart vps
确保配置生效
在完成上述操作后,确保VPS服务正常运行,你可以通过以下命令检查服务状态:
sudo systemctl status vps
如果服务状态正常,VPS应该已经连接到对应的VM,并且配置生效。
注意事项
- 备份数据:在进行任何重置或配置操作之前,请确保你备份了所有重要的数据。
- 测试环境:如果你不确定如何配置VPS,可以在测试环境中进行操作。
- 备份VPS配置:在进行重大配置更改之前,备份当前的配置文件。
通过VM重置VPS是一种常见的操作,尤其是在需要调整网络设置、重启服务或重置密码时,了解如何通过VM管理VPS可以帮助你更高效地维护和管理你的虚拟化服务,如果你对命令行操作不熟悉,也可以通过图形界面(如VPS管理器)完成这些操作,希望这篇文章能帮助你更好地理解如何通过VM重置VPS!
卡尔云官网
www.kaeryun.com